Uyo Zonal EFCC Arrest Eight Suspected Internet Fraudsters

Operatives of the Uyo Zonal Directorate of the Economic and Financial Crimes Commission (EFCC) on May 22, 2025, arrested eight suspected internet fraudsters at different locations in Abia state.

They were arrested following credible intelligence on their suspected involvement in internet-related offences.

Items recovered from the suspects include four exotic vehicles, 20 mobile phones and two laptops.

Investigation is still ongoing and the suspects will be charged to court thereafter.

Internet fraud has become a source of concern in Nigeria with many youths in the country trapped in the heinous crime.
